The push buttons consist of an actuator, a module carrier, and an N/O contact module and/or an N/C contact module. The following characteristics differentiate the different versions:

  • Height of the button plate
  • Actuator function type: momentary and latching
  • Color of the button plate

Button with yellow light

The illuminated push buttons also consist of an actuator, a module carrier, and an N/O contact module and/or an N/C contact module. The buttons also have an LED module as a light source. The following characteristics differentiate the different versions:

  • Height of the button plate
  • Actuator function type: momentary and latching
  • Color of the button plate
  • Color of the LED module

Printed button

The printed buttons consist of an actuator, a module carrier, and an N/O contact module and/or an N/C contact module. The following characteristic differentiates the different versions:

  • Push element

Blue mushroom-head push button

Depending on how the mushroom-head push buttons are connected, the contact modules can be closed or interrupted with the button. The mushroom-head push buttons have a large button plate with a diameter of 40 mm. The following characteristic differentiates the different versions:

  • Color of the actuator plate

Emergency stop buttons

The emergency stop buttons, also known as "emergency switching off" buttons comply with the IEC/EN 60947-5-5, GB 14048.14 and EN 13850 standards for interlocking. The emergency stop button is actuated by pressing it, whereby it latches into the end position. This ensures that the emergency stop remains in place until the button is deliberately unlocked. The following characteristics differentiate the emergency stop buttons:

  • Turn to unlock
  • Pull to unlock

Selector switches

The selector switches are available with two or three switch positions. Depending on the model, the products are available with a button or latching function. The following characteristics differentiate the selector switches:

  • Switch positions
  • Switching function

Selector switches with lighting

The selector switches are available with two or three switch positions. Depending on the model, the products are available with a button or latching function. The following characteristics differentiate the selector switches:

  • Switch positions
  • Switching function
  • Color of the actuator
  • LED color

Key switches

An actuator key is required to prevent unauthorized and unintentional actuation. The key switches are available with two or three switch positions. The following characteristics differentiate the different versions:

  • Switch positions
  • Switch function
  • Key removal position

Red indicator light

The indicator lights are equipped with an LED and an IC chip. This combination enables mains connection at AC/DC 24-240 V. The following characteristic differentiates the different versions:

  • Color

Yellow buzzer

Buzzers are acoustic signaling devices that produce a sound to signal a condition or warning.

Individual modules for buttons, switches, and indicator lights

Modular kits are also available in addition to the preconfigured product versions. The modular versions consist of the following individual components:

  1. Actuating element (here using the example of a push button)
  2. Module holder
  3. Contact module
  4. LED module (optional)

Actuating element

The actuators and indicator lights are manufactured to a high standard and consist of the following elements:

  • Actuating element (here using the example of a rotary switch)
  • Metal ring
  • Seal
  • Fastening nut

Module holders

The module holders are designed to hold actuators, contact modules, and LED modules and can be used with a front panel with a thickness of 1 to 6 mm.

Contact modules – N/C contact

The contact modules have a slow-action contact that is available either as an N/O contact or N/C contact. The N/O contact module is identified by a green slider, whereas the N/C contact module is identified by a red slider.

The N/C module complies with IEC 60947-5-1.

Green LED module

The LED modules with integrated LED are available in the following colors:

  • White
  • Red
  • Green
  • Yellow
  • Blue

Empty enclosures for buttons, switches, and indicator lights

The housings for buttons and switches are made of a high-strength, flame-retardant material. They are characterized by high vibration resistance, temperature resistance, incombustibility, and a pronounced resistance to deformation.
With a degree of protection of up to IP66, the housings offer reliable protection:

  • Dust-proof
  • Watertight
  • Corrosion-resistant

The housings are designed to accommodate one to five buttons and meet the highest safety and durability requirements.
